python如何从键盘输入列表?

供稿:hz-xin.com     日期:2025-01-13

要从键盘输入列表,可以使用input()函数结合列表推导式。您可以按照以下示例代码的格式进行输入:

上述代码将从键盘读取一个字符串,该字符串包含用空格分隔的元素。然后,split()函数将字符串拆分为一个列表,并使用int()函数将每个元素转换为整数类型。最终,将得到一个整数列表,存储在名为my_list的变量中。

如果您想输入一个字符串列表,而不是整数列表,可以省略int()函数,并直接使用以下代码:

在这种情况下,将获得一个字符串列表。



可以使用Python的input()函数来从键盘输入列表,例如:
list = input("Please enter a list of numbers: ").split()
print(list)

python如何输入任意个数值?
Python中可以使用input()函数获取用户输入,可以使用循环结构来实现输入任意个数值的功能。以下是两种常见的方法:方法一:使用while循环和try...except结构 nums = []while True:try:num = input("请输入一个数字(按回车键结束,输入非数字停止输入):")num = float(num)nums.append(num)except:...

用python从键盘输入一个字符串,统计其中大写小写字母以及数字的个数...
1、可以这样编写程序:定义一个含有所有小写字母的列表变量w及一个待测字符串变量s。对s字符串中的每一个字符进行循环迭代检测其是否位于变量w中,若为真,则对计数变量c进行加一操作。输出c变量,即为所求。2、初学者的话确实可以通过asciitable来判断字母和数字的区别。Python里面有两个内置函数ord和...

Python:通过键盘输入一系列值,输入0则表示输入结束,将这些值不包含0建...
def addList(List):a = raw_input()if a == '0':duprint List else:List.append(a)addList(List)addList([])或:include<stdio.h> int WhichMore(int x[],int n){ int j=0,o=0;for(int i=0;i<n;i++)if(x[i]%2==0)o++;else j++;return o-j;} int main(){ int ...

用python编写脚本程序,实现用户输入3个整数,放入列表,并输出最小值_百...
list1 = input("请输入3个以空格为间隔的整数:").split()"""以空格进行分割,删去字符串中的空格,剩下的元素以列表形式返回"""print("最小值为:",min(list1)) #利用内置函数min()返回最小值

python:通过while循环键盘录入字符串存入列表?
L=[]while True:n=input('请录入字符')L.append(n)if n=='OK': lens=0 for i in L: if len(i)>5: lens=lens+1 with open('work.txt','a') as f: f.write(i)if lens==0:print('没有符合条件的元素,work.txt文件内容为空!')break ...

在python中输入一个数字列表,使用切片将奇数位上的数乘2,偶数位上的数...
list=[int(x) for x in input("输入数字列表,数字间用空格隔开:").split()]使用切片 print([x*2 for x in list[1::2]])print([x+10 for x in list[::2]])不使用切片 print([x+10 if i%2==0 else x*2 for i,x in enumerate(list)])

编程,输入n个数(n从键盘输入,且不大于20),先用冒泡法按从小到大的顺序...
", nums)```首先通过 `input()` 函数获取用户输入的 `n` 值,然后通过循环和 `input()` 函数获取 `n` 个数,并存储在列表 `nums` 中。接着,使用两层循环实现冒泡排序,将列表 `nums` 中的数按从小到大的顺序排列。最后,使用 `print()` 函数输出排序后的结果。

python中输入一个list
-*- coding:UTF-8 -*- infos = raw_input("请输入经纬度列表")list_info = eval(infos)for i in list_info: print i

Python123(列表)
输入 第一行输入用空格分隔的两个正整数n和m。随后的m行,每行输入用空格分隔的n个成绩。输出 分行输出每门课的平均成绩。代码 绝对值排序描述 读入一个列表,按照绝对值从大到小排序,如果绝对值相同,则正数在前面。例如列表[3,-4,2,4],排序后的结果为[4,-4,3,2]输入 题目的输入为一行,...

python由小到大排列?
2、输入print列表名即可得到排序后的列表数据。倒序可以用这个reverse方法,把元素位置倒转过来。然后再次print列表名,这样就会得到倒转顺序之后的列表数据。如图两相对比即实现了从高到低和从低到高排序。3、在Python中,对于两个集合A和B,它们的并集可以使用union()方法或者|运算符实现。这个操作的结果是...